Everything you know about drug addiction is wrong This is worth reading. All that science we have on addiction and how rats will drink cocaine-laced water to the exclusion of eating and sleeping and everything else? Turns out that rats who aren’t bored and isolated and being kept in tiny, unnatural cages where they have literally nothing else to do OTHER than take drugs have very little interest in drugs. A scientist built, basically, a rat park filled with toys and entertainment and friends, and not only did the rats in the rat park dislike the drug-laced water, addicted rats who were released into the park had a bit of withdrawal, but then stopped their heavy use and went back to living normal rat lives. The lack of stress and presence of pleasant forms of mental stimulation and the company of their own kind un-addicted them. Everything about how we’re conducting the war on drugs is based on bad assumptions. (via jessicalprice) |
